Jenny Karr
Food was delicious and they were very accommodating for all my weird requests/substitutions. I got the salmon and substituted the pasta for the sautéed vegetables (which were amazing!!) It was all really good, but I was a little taken back by how expensive it was considering the vibe of the room which feels more on the casual side. The price is why I gave it a 4 instead of a 5. For three people, it was $77 before tip. I did also take note of someone else’s bad review about the salad and asked for the dressing on the side and I was glad I did after seeing someone else’s salad with too much dressing.

E A Stone
We had the chicken fried steak and shrimp Alfredo with the crabs stuffed mushrooms w sauce. Also, garlic bread knots. My husband enjoyed the chicken fried steak. The Alfredo was good; perfect pasta. The staff told us that the seafood was a Sysco brand. Next time, I will ask them to put the sauce on the side of the stuffed mushrooms. It was too much, and overwhelmed the flavor of the crab. Our waiter was professional and responsive to our questions. From the outside, it’s not as welcoming as what the menu presents. In fact, we thought it was closed. I’m glad we took a chance because it was a nice surprise. I regret not trying the Italian cake. : ) If you did, let us know.
